2847. William TINKER

NAME: Interviews with Blanche Underhill Zickgraf; 1968-1977; conducted by
Wiliam Grant Zickgraf; in her home in Franklin, NC; notes in possession of
William Grant Zickgraf.

LAND: Tax records, Genesee Co., MI; 15 Aug 1873; ; Taxes for the year 1872;
Genesee County Treasurer's office; W1/2 of SW1/4, Sec 8, Twp 9, range 7E,
80 acres and E1/2 of SW1/4, Section 8, Town 9, Range 7E, 80 acres.

OCCUPATION: Pine Run, OH Newspaper article; ; ; ; Machinist, manufacturer of
steam engines, operated shingle mill, made saw mill parts, operated saw mill,
manufactured farm implements and did equipment repair in Ashtabula, OH prior to
1865 and Clio, MI after 1865.

BURIAL: Pine Run, MI cemetery; ; ; ; William G. Zickgraf visited the cemetery
in 1992 and inspected the tombstone.

BIOGRAPHY: Interview with Lois Ridley of Clio, MI; 1994; ; ; ; West of the cor-
ners on the north side of the road, stood the foundry and machine shop of
William Tinker & Son, who came to the locality in 1865, they were first class
mechanics who could make almost anything that could be fashioned from iron,
steel or wood, at one time they made shingles and cheese boxes, he built a
track & cart to bring the logs to the second floor for sawing, William was
6'7".

RESIDENCE: Interview with Earl Underhill of Flint, MI; 1992; ; ;
His home still stands on the west side of Saginaw Road just two blocks south of
the Vienna Road corner in Pine Run, MI, One group of Tinkers came around Lake
Ontario to Michigan and another group of Tinkers came around Lake Ontario to
Ohio.
